However, you should push yourself to speak in English. It is an extremely important ability to have.

 

Are you going to live in Canada? Yes- You don’t want to live in Canada and not be able to speak well.

not fun for you – can’t talk to people, can’t talk on the telephone, can’t understand what people are saying

 

You can have better.

 

SECRET – Practice. Daily practice.

 

For example, I play music. I practice every day. It’s important to me to be a good musician.

 

What is important to you? Do you practice it every day?

- sports - basketball, soccer, badminton, pingpong

- health – yoga, taichi, stretching

- health – drink water (2-3 litres), good food

- good person – kindness, generous, volunteer

 

Is English important to you? – in your heart!! really

If not, then you won’t practice.

If it is, then PRACTICE every day.

- schedule – writing, speaking, reading, listening

 

This class is just one opportunity to learn some English. I will teach you a lot about writing and reading in English.

There are many opportunities outside of class for you to improve your English. Find opportunities and take them. Don’t wait.
